Travis Scott To Release New Album 'Astroworld' This Week
Monday, 30 July 2018
Written by Jon Stickler
Travis Scott has confirmed that he will release the long awaited 'Astroworld' this Friday, August 3.
The announcement is accompanied by a trailer for the album, which is sountracked by the Houston rapper's new song, Stargazing. Back in May, Scott unveiled the record's lead single, Watch, a collaboration with Kanye West and Lil Uzi Vert.
Scott has been busy since the release of 2016's 'Birds in the Trap Sing McKnight'. In 2017 he teamed up with Quavo for their collaborative project, 'Huncho Jack, Jack Huncho'. He's also linked up with artists Miguel, Rae Sremmurd and Playboi Carti.
Scott will return to the UK next month for appearances at Reading and Leeds.
